- Symphony (Vierne)'s instance of is recorded as musical work/composition[3].
- Symphony (Vierne)'s composer is recorded as Louis Vierne[4].
- Symphony (Vierne)'s country of origin is recorded as France[5].
- January 26, 1919 marks the founding of Symphony (Vierne)[6].
- Symphony (Vierne)'s tonality is recorded as A minor[7].
- Symphony (Vierne)'s form of creative work is recorded as symphony[8].
- Symphony (Vierne)'s opus number is recorded as 24[9].
